Ganymede seems to have many ocean levels, stacked up with levels of ice in between them. The highest level of ice would be the crust, which could be about one hundred fifty kilometers (about ninety miles) thick. Ganymede, Jupiter’s greatest moon, and the largest moon within the Photo voltaic Procedure, offers a singular composition and physical make-up. Differentiated into an internal iron-sulfide Main and a silicate mantle, it includes a subsurface ocean sustained because of the sluggish cooling of its liquid core. Ganymede is the sole moon recognized to possess its have magnetic industry, generated by its Main.
NASA experiences that Callisto will be the third biggest satellite while in the solar procedure and about the scale of Mercury. Pictured here in color, NASA points out that its quite a few markings clearly show a turbulent background of collisions with Room objects. In truth, Callisto is thought to get quite possibly the most closely cratered object in our photo voltaic system.
